A woman in Texas posted a TikTok showing why she feels safe going out in public alone as long as she has her dog with her.

Caley Starkes, who lives in East Texas, has an adorable pit bull named Denali who does a great job of protecting his owner. The video Starkes posted shows Denali standing in front of her and staring down something off-screen as it passes.

Starkes' video explains that this is what he does when a car drives by too slow near his mom:
